She fashions each individual piece by hand using a freeblowing technique that ensures that each signed and dated piece is unique.
Siddy's
glasswork is translucent, and the colours have a rich three-dimensional
quality. They convey her deeply held beliefs about
the richness and value of our environment and its fragility and
vulnerability. Siddy is a keen diver and the glass conveys her wonder and
fascination at the richness of life on the sea bed. She has never lost that
fascination that children have when they first pick up a marble and hold it
to the light - that tiny world inside the glass, constantly changing as the
